About the role

In this rewarding role you will join our award- winning Cancer Information Development team dedicated to producing and updating a wide range of high-quality accessible information for people living with cancer.

This includes helping people understand more about diagnosis, treatments, side effects and what can help when they’re living with and after cancer. Timely, accurate and up to date information can make all the difference – not only to a person with cancer but their family and friends too.

You’ll be involved in writing, reviewing, editing, and developing content on a broad range of clinical and non-clinical topics. You’ll work with our editors and teams across Macmillan as well as people living with cancer, and health professionals to produce quality assured information for different audiences.

Your clinical knowledge and cancer experience will be a valuable resource for colleagues in Macmillan helping us to ensure the charity is focused on the needs of people living with cancer. By playing a key part in our services, you’ll directly help people living with cancer feel informed, empowered and supported.
